Bowedness

/ˈbaʊdnəs/ noun

Definition

The quality or state of being bowed, curved, or bent.

Etymology

From 'bowed' (adjective, meaning bent or curved) plus the abstract noun suffix -ness, which turns adjectives into nouns describing their quality.
